Summary/Objective Primary function is to administer highly skilled private duty nursing care to pediatric patients/clients, in their places of residence; coordinate care with the interdisciplinary team, patient/client, their family and referring agency. This role requires a seasoned nurse, with pediatric home health experience, willing to travel and confident in their skills to initiate care in the patient’s home under the supervision of a registered nurse.

Supervisory Responsibility: No
Works in multiple patients’/clients’ homes in various conditions; possible exposure to blood, bodily fluids and infectious diseases; must have ability to work a flexible schedule and to travel locally; some exposure to unpleasant weather
Prolonged standing and walking required, with ability to lift up to 50lbs and move patients/clients.
Requires working under some stressful conditions to meet deadlines and patient/client needs, and to make quick decisions and resource acquisition; meet patient/client and family individualized psychosocial needs.
Requires hand-eye coordination and manual dexterity.
Requires ability to adapt quickly to newly established patients onboarding to the agency including new families to homecare or from hospital to home or changing agencies.
Requires ability to work within dynamic team of transitioning care to established private duty nursing team.
Requires ability to teach and train caregivers and other nurses on team.
Requires excellent communication to supervisor, team members, parent, and physicians.
11. Highly skilled care including but not limited to ventilator management/trouble shooting, tracheostomy care/management, enteral/gastrostomy care management.
